Effect of Different Rooting Media for Rooting Success and Survivability of Marcottage in Pomegranate (Punica granatum L.) C.V. Bhagwa
Intjar Singh Dawar*, T. R. Sharma, O. P. Nagar and Shreesty Pal
Department of Horticulture, College of Agriculture JNKVV, Jabalpur, (MP), India
*Corresponding author
Abstract:

The present investigation entitled “Effect of different Rooting Media for Rooting Success and Survivability of Marcottage in Pomegranate (Punica granatum L.) C.V. Bhagwa” was conducted at Fruit Research Station, Imalia, Department of Horticulture, College of Agriculture, J.N.K.V.V., Jabalpur (M.P.) during the year 2018- 2019. The experiment was laid out in Factorial Randomized Block Design with three replications. Among different treatments Soil + Vermicompost + Azospirillum + IBA 5000ppm was most effective in rooting success at DAT 60, 90 (100%, 93.33%) and survivability at DAT 120 (93.33%) followed by the treatment with Soil + VC + Pseudomonas + IBA 5000. This treatment also resulted maximum percentage of rooted layers (97.77%), and rooting and growth parameter number of primary root (16.40), number of secondary root (32.80), length of primary root (14.20 cm), length of secondary root (6.28 cm), longest length of root DAL 45 (15.88 cm), diameter of primary root (4.01 mm), diameter of secondary root 2.20 mm). it may be concluded that Soil + Vermicompost + Azospirillum + IBA 5000ppm can be applied for suitable marcottage in pomegranate at “kaymore plateau and satpura hils’’ agro climatic zone of Madhya Pradesh.
